[deleted by user] by [deleted] in BirminghamUK

[–]LSDFleminem 5 points6 points  (0 children)

Where are you moving from?

You’ll need to be “street smart” if you’re moving into a place that cheap especially in an area like Kingstanding. For £80pw you’re probably looking at a really shit HMO if you’re going private and places like that are catered especially for people who have low income or out of prison services. So, basically, you’re looking at lodging with people who are likely to try and exploit a young (vulnerable) person.

Maybe consider looking for a house share that the homeowner lives in.

Birmingham is expensive and anything that seems too good to be true most definitely is.

Edit: I just looked on Rightmove for properties like that around me and the vast majority are supported living or only accept people on benefits. Consider looking on Facebook or gumtree or look at going to college in a cheaper city/town if you have no links here. Good luck.

What could this fluid be by streetlightfans in MechanicAdvice

[–]LSDFleminem 0 points1 point  (0 children)

If water has been used instead of coolant due to a leak on your head gasket or radiator, it can cause oxidation inside the coolant system which then rusts.

Flush it, leak detect, repair and then fill with correct coolant.
